This alert updates the advice sent on 31st January 2020. Changes from the previous version are highlighted in blue font. The key changes are to the case definition. These include the expansion of geography for clinical case definition from mainland China to mainland China, Thailand, Japan, Republic of Korea, Hong Kong, Taiwan, Singapore, Malaysia and Macau; and the modification of the clinical case definition so that fever without any other symptoms is sufficient criteria for testing (if the patient has also travelled from or transited through the previously names countries in the previous 14 days). Alternative clinical diagnosis for fever in a returning traveller should be considered and tests performed at local NHS laboratories, according to published PHE guidance.
